Output 895728cc27fde3343ad6e7a2ff39b9e27d29553571200c9c7a8fd54bb58fb175:5

value
5183628
script pubkey
OP_0 OP_PUSHBYTES_20 bb31d6a49c05e7cd9b9543094c5a45d84c4e4673
address
bc1qhvcadfyuqhnumxu4gvy5ckj9mpxyu3nnf0js3t
transaction
895728cc27fde3343ad6e7a2ff39b9e27d29553571200c9c7a8fd54bb58fb175
spent
true